5 of 5 stars Reviewed 21 April 2013

Fantastic beer, fantastic food, extremely friendly helpful staff. We enjoyed our meals so much we went back the next evening. This pub has a great restaurant but also nice comfy sofas to enjoy a drink after a long hike. Great views across the dale too.

5 of 5 stars Reviewed 15 January 2013

Excellent local made game pate. Good locally shot pheasant. If you stay at the hotel, you have no need to consider eating elsewhere. No dislikes.
